WebbThe blade has a primary bevel ground on one side (the underside), and is ready for sharpening. It is fairly easy to achieve a good edge from that state just using stones. Work on the bevelled side, hold the blade bevel up, with the beard (widest part) towards you and stroke the stone away from you along the blade to the toe (point).

A quick tutorial on the proper method of sharpening a fishing hook using a hook file, available at pretty much every bait and tackle shop … WebbBillhooks are almost universally made from ordinary steel of a moderate carbon content. High-carbon steel is not often used since an extremely sharp and hard edge is not necessary, and a slightly lower carbon content makes the …
